Image Part Manufacturer Description Price Stock Action
DSTL-0216-12 Delta Electronics
Solenoids & Actuators Solen...
-
RFQ
325
In-stock
Get Quote
DSTL-0216-05 Delta Electronics
Solenoids & Actuators Solen...
-
RFQ
314
In-stock
Get Quote
DSTL-0216-18 Delta Electronics
Solenoids & Actuators Solen...
-
RFQ
5,000
In-stock
Get Quote
DSTL-0216-24 Delta Electronics
Solenoids & Actuators Solen...
-
RFQ
5,000
In-stock
Get Quote
DSTL-0216-09 Delta Electronics
Solenoids & Actuators Solen...
-
RFQ
5,000
In-stock
Get Quote
1 / 1 Page, 5 Records